Output 03bcb3eaa9e0c949b30baf7109bc5368c1766ca3f0a95bb08f8cb1586a69d655:0

value
19576817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1c09254895dcaf5d3e6ec1efa0cc44c355fddf5 OP_EQUAL
address
3PjHTtFLsUtK8DejRhXqMgRY1tnPxD3LkP
transaction
03bcb3eaa9e0c949b30baf7109bc5368c1766ca3f0a95bb08f8cb1586a69d655
spent
true